Description


Pluto's motion has been represented with series resulting of an approximation by frequency analysis (see Chapront 1995) of JPL numerical integration DE200. Series represent the heliocentric coordinates of Pluto as functions of time between 1700 and 2100. This catalog completes the VSOP87 theories developed at the Bureau des Longitudes (see Cat. <VI/81>)
